Janet Napolitano Discusses Cyber Executive Orders and Intellectual Property

Department of Homeland Security Secretary Janet Napolitano addresses a National Journal symposium regarding a pending executive order on cybersecurity. The discussion focuses on the administration's intent to bypass Congress to implement information-sharing and liability protections for corporations, while expanding the definition of national security to include intellectual property theft.

Al Franken, Joe Lieberman, and Senate Floor Time Disputes

Senator Al Franken, acting as the presiding officer of the Senate, denied Senator Joe Lieberman an extension of time to finish his remarks on the health care bill. Senator John McCain expressed shock at the move, claiming it was the first time in his twenty-year career he had seen a colleague denied a routine minute to conclude. The strict enforcement of time limits was attributed to a party-led effort to expedite the passage of the health care legislation.
